The demand for high-strength, lightweight materials is increasing exponentially, fueled by the automotive industrys push for fuel efficiency and the aerospace industrys pursuit of lighter, more fuel-efficient aircraft. CFRTP materials perfectly meet these needs, offering a unique combination of high strength-to-weight ratios, improved durability, and design flexibility compared to traditional materials like metals and unreinforced polymers.
Technological advancements in fiber production, resin systems, and manufacturing processes are further accelerating market growth. Developments in continuous fiber production techniques lead to improved fiber quality and consistency, enabling the creation of more robust and reliable CFRTP composites. Innovations in resin systems enhance the materials thermal and chemical resistance, expanding its application possibilities. Furthermore, advancements in manufacturing technologies, such as automated fiber placement (AFP) and tape laying (ATL), are increasing the efficiency and scalability of CFRTP production, making them more cost-effective.

The Continuous Fiber Reinforced Thermoplastic (CFRTP) market refers to the complete value chain involved in the production and application of continuous fiber-reinforced thermoplastic composite materials. This includes the production of raw materials (fibers like carbon fiber, glass fiber, aramid fiber and thermoplastic resins), the manufacturing of CFRTP components and parts using various techniques (e.g., automated fiber placement, tape laying), the processing of these components, and their final integration into end-products across various sectors.
The markets components consist of the suppliers of raw materials, the manufacturers of CFRTP components, the processors who perform secondary operations on CFRTP parts (e.g., machining, finishing), and the end-users who integrate CFRTP into their final products. Key terms associated with the market include:
Continuous Fiber: Fibers that are long and uninterrupted, leading to higher strength and stiffness compared to short fibers.
Thermoplastic Resin: A type of polymer that softens and becomes moldable upon heating and solidifies upon cooling. This allows for easier processing and recycling compared to thermoset resins.
Reinforcement: The structural strengthening provided by the continuous fibers within the thermoplastic matrix.
Automated Fiber Placement (AFP): A manufacturing process where continuous fibers are precisely placed onto a mold to create complex composite parts.
Tape Laying (ATL): Similar to AFP, but uses pre-impregnated tapes of fiber and resin.
Composite: A material made from two or more constituent materials with significantly different physical or chemical properties that, when combined, create a material with enhanced properties.

Carbon Fiber CFRTP: Offers the highest strength-to-weight ratio among the different fiber types. Its high cost restricts its use to high-performance applications in aerospace and automotive industries where performance and lightweighting are paramount. This segment is expected to experience substantial growth driven by increasing demand in these high-value applications.
Glass Fiber CFRTP: Provides a balance between cost and performance. Glass fiber CFRTP is widely used in applications requiring moderate strength and stiffness at a lower cost than carbon fiber. This segment enjoys a large market share due to its cost-effectiveness and versatility across various applications.
Aramid Fiber CFRTP: Known for its high strength and toughness, especially in impact resistance. Aramid fiber CFRTP finds applications in areas requiring high impact resistance and ballistic protection. This segments growth is driven by demand in specialized applications within the defense and security sectors.

The CFRTP market faces significant challenges that could hinder its growth trajectory. One major challenge is the high initial cost of CFRTP materials and manufacturing processes compared to traditional materials like steel or aluminum. This cost barrier can be a significant deterrent for adoption, especially in price-sensitive markets. Furthermore, the limited scalability of current manufacturing technologies can restrict the widespread adoption of CFRTP. While automated fiber placement (AFP) and tape laying (ATL) are improving production efficiency, these technologies are not yet as easily scalable as traditional manufacturing methods, limiting the ability to meet large-scale demand.
Another critical challenge is the complexity of the design and manufacturing process. Designing and manufacturing CFRTP components often requires specialized expertise and advanced software tools, increasing the overall project cost and lead time. The lack of readily available skilled labor in CFRTP manufacturing further exacerbates this challenge. The recycling and end-of-life management of CFRTP components also present significant hurdles. Although certain CFRTP materials are recyclable, the infrastructure for recycling these materials is still underdeveloped, leading to concerns about waste management and environmental impact. Finally, the market faces competition from other lightweighting materials, such as advanced aluminum alloys and carbon fiber reinforced polymers (CFRP) using thermoset resins. These materials may offer certain advantages in specific applications, creating competition for market share. Overcoming these challenges will require significant investment in research and development, improvements in manufacturing processes, and the development of a more robust recycling infrastructure.
